H2275 Hebrew

חֶבְרוֹן

Chebrôwn (kheb-rone')
Chebron, a place in Palestine, also the name of two Israelites

KJV Translations of H2275

Hebron.

Word Origin & Derivation

from H2267 (חֶבֶר); seat of association;
